New Residential Construction Report: October 2012

Today’s New Residential Construction Report showed mixed results for October with monthly gains in single family permits but losses to total permits while total starts increased as single family starts declined over the same period.

Single family housing permits, the most leading of indicators, rose 2.2% from September to 562K single family units (SAAR), and increased 26.2% above the level seen in October 2011 but still remained an astonishing 68.74% below the peak in September 2005.

Single family housing starts declined 0.2% from September to 594K units (SAAR), and climbed 35.3% above the level seen in October 2011 but still remained 67.4% below the peak set in early 2006.
